Pappakudi Village Population - Valangaiman, Thiruvarur, Tamil Nadu

Pappakudi is a village located in Valangaiman Taluk of Thiruvarur district in Tamil Nadu. Around 174 families reside in Pappakudi village. Pappakudi village is administered by Sarpanch(Head of village) who is elected every five years.

As per the Census India 2011, Pappakudi village has population of 682 of which 336 are males and 346 are females. The population of children between age 0-6 is 71 which is 10.41% of total population.

The sex-ratio of Pappakudi village is around 1030 compared to 996 which is average of Tamil Nadu state. The literacy rate of Pappakudi village is 79.33% out of which 81.85% males are literate and 76.88% females are literate. There are 44.57% Scheduled Caste (SC) and 0 Scheduled Tribe (ST) of total population in Pappakudi village.
